How Aaron Barone Gave Ian Simpson a Taste of His Own Medicine
Summary
Before the 888poker LIVE London Main Event, Team 888poker faced off with a few streamers in a single-table Ambassador Sit & Go. The roster included Ian Simpson, Nick Eastwood, Vivian Saliba, Lucia Navarro, Aaron Barone, Jack Dean and others. Simpson spent the game urging slowrolling as a cheeky table tactic — only to have Aaron Barone return the favour in spectacular style.
Early exits saw bambinobecky and Jack Dean eliminated, followed by Nick Eastwood and Lucia Navarro. Simpson built a big stack and bullied his way through several pots, but after Barone spiked an ace to double through him, Simpson jammed with 3-2 on a queen-deuce-ace board. Barone, who had flopped a set of queens, theatrically tanked then called — showing Simpson the goods and delivering some well-timed karma. Barone then beat Inaki Angulo heads-up to take the title.
